• Intent 、Intent Filter 和传输数据


    Intent  使用

    最常使用的是:

    Intent intent = new Intent();
    intent.setClass(Main.this,New.class);
    startActivity(intent);

    其他的Intent 的使用:

    打开一个网站:

    Uri uri = Uri.parse("http://www.shike.im/");
    Intent it = new Intent(Intent.ACTION_VIEW, uri);
    startActivity(it);

    打开一个音乐

    Intent it = new Intent(Intent.ACTION_VIEW);
    File file = new File("/sdcard/song.mp3");
    it.setDataAndType(Uri.fromFile(file), "audio/*");
    startActivity(it);

    打开一个图片:

    Intent it = new Intent(Intent.ACTION_VIEW);
    File file = new File("/sdcard/image.png");
    it.setDataAndType(Uri.fromFile(file), "image/*");
    startActivity(it);

  • 相关阅读:
    Rocket
    Rocket
    Rocket
    Rocket
    Rocket
    Rocket
    UVa 10534 DP LIS Wavio Sequence
    LA 4256 DP Salesmen
    HDU 2476 区间DP String painter
    HDU 4283 区间DP You Are the One
  • 原文地址:https://www.cnblogs.com/zhoujn/p/4157285.html
Copyright © 2020-2023  润新知